Description

The BG95-M3 is a module from Quectel designed for IoT applications, supporting LTE Cat M1, NB-IoT, and GSM. It features a compact form factor, making it suitable for various use cases, including smart meters, asset tracking, and wearables. The module is equipped with multiple interfaces, including UART, I2C, and GPIO, enabling easy integration with different hardware platforms.
It supports GPS/GNSS for location tracking and has low power consumption modes, making it ideal for battery-operated devices. The BG95-M3 is compliant with global cellular standards, ensuring broad compatibility and connectivity across regions. Its firmware is upgradeable, allowing for future enhancements and added functionalities.
Overall, the BG95-M3 is a versatile choice for developers looking to build reliable and efficient IoT solutions.

Features

The BG95-M3 is a multi-band cellular module designed by Quectel, tailored for IoT applications. Key features include:
1. Multi-Band Support: Operates on LTE Cat M1, NB-IoT, and GSM networks, ensuring wide compatibility.
2. Low Power Consumption: Optimized for energy efficiency, making it ideal for battery-powered devices.
3. Compact Size: Small form factor (28.2 x 26.0 x 2.6 mm), suitable for space-constrained applications.
4. Global Coverage: Supports a variety of frequency bands, enabling global deployment.
5. Integrated GNSS: Offers positioning capabilities with built-in GPS, GLONASS, BeiDou, and Galileo support.
6. Data Rates: Delivers maximum data rates of up to 375 kbps for LTE Cat M1.
7. Rich Interfaces: Features UART, I2C, SPI, and GPIO interfaces for versatile connectivity.
8. Security Features: Includes robust security measures for secure data transmission.
9. Robust Design: Designed to operate in challenging environments with extended temperature ranges.
These features make the BG95-M3 suitable for various IoT applications, including smart meters, asset tracking, and industrial automation.

Pinout

The BG95-M3 module, part of Quectel's BG95 series, features a 38-pin LGA (Land Grid Array) footprint. The pins serve various functions, including:
1. Power Supply: For connecting the module to a power source.
2. Ground: Multiple pins provide grounding for stability.
3. UART: Serial communication interface for data exchange.
4. I2C: For connecting sensors and peripherals.
5. GPIO: General-purpose input/output pins for custom functions.
6. ADC: Analog-to-digital converter pins for analog signal processing.
7. SIM interface: For connecting a SIM card.
8. RF Interface: Antenna connections for cellular communication.
9. LED Indicators: For status indication.
The BG95-M3 supports LTE-M, NB-IoT, and GNSS, making it suitable for IoT applications. The pin configuration allows for versatile integration into various electronic designs.

Manufacturer

The BG95-M3 is manufactured by Quectel Wireless Solutions, a global provider of IoT (Internet of Things) modules. Founded in 2010 and headquartered in Shanghai, China, Quectel specializes in designing and manufacturing cellular, GNSS (Global Navigation Satellite System), and Wi-Fi modules for various applications, including automotive, industrial, smart cities, and consumer electronics. The BG95-M3 is a multi-technology module that supports LTE-M and NB-IoT connectivity, enabling low-power, wide-area network solutions ideal for IoT deployments. Quectel is recognized for its innovative products and commitment to advancing IoT technology across diverse industries.

Equivalent

The BG95-M3 chip, produced by Quectel, is a multi-band LTE and GNSS module. Equivalent products include the u-blox SARA-R5 series, Telit LE910C1 and LE910C4 series, and the Sierra Wireless HL7800. These alternatives provide similar LTE connectivity and GNSS capabilities suitable for IoT applications. Always verify compatibility based on specific project requirements.
